Most email nurture programs are not systems. They are broadcast schedules with personalization tokens – sequences built around what marketing teams believe buyers need, sent at intervals marketing teams find convenient, measured by metrics that confirm activity without confirming progress. They fail not because of poor content or insufficient sends. They fail because they are designed around internal assumptions about buyer behavior instead of actual buyer signals. The fix is not a better sequence. It is a different system architecture – one that reads intent patterns, feeds buyer confidence, and stops sending when signals drop.
Why Email Nurture Programs Fail Before the First Send
The failure in most B2B email nurture strategy is baked in at the design stage. Before a single email goes out, the sequencing logic has already been built on a foundation that cannot hold: the assumption that the team knows where buyers are, what they care about, and what they need to move forward.
The Assumption Gap – Building Sequences on Guessed Buyer Stages
The Assumption Gap is the specific failure mode where internal marketing assumptions about buyer journey replace actual buyer behavior data. It is not a content problem. It is not a frequency problem. It is an epistemological problem – the system is operating on beliefs rather than signals.
It shows up three ways. The team assigns buyers to journey stages based on the content they downloaded, not the decisions they are navigating. The sequence advances on a time delay because no intent signal is available to trigger progression. And when results are reviewed, engagement metrics (opens, clicks) are used as evidence the system is working – even when pipeline contribution is flat.
The Assumption Gap does not announce itself. It looks like a functioning nurture program until pipeline review reveals that hundreds of contacts have completed the sequence and none have moved to a sales conversation.
Why TOFU/MOFU/BOFU Breaks on Contact with a Real Buyer
The top-of-funnel, middle-of-funnel, bottom-of-funnel model was a useful simplification when content marketing was new. It is now a constraint. It imposes a linear journey on buyers who do not move linearly. Real buying journeys pause. They loop back when new stakeholders join. They go quiet during internal budget conversations that have nothing to do with your content.
A nurture system built on funnel stages will always misfire for the same reason: it treats buyer position as a content classification problem. The buyer is not asking “what stage am I in?” They are asking “do I understand this well enough to act, and can I defend that action internally?” Those are questions about confidence, not content buckets.
The Difference Between Engagement Signals and Intent Patterns
An engagement signal is a single recorded behavior: an email opened, a link clicked, a PDF downloaded. An intent pattern is a cluster of signals – across time, content type, role, and recency – that together indicate a buyer is actively navigating a purchase decision. Treating engagement signals as intent is the most common and most damaging mistake in intent-based lead nurturing. It is how leads get pushed to sales too early, how sales teams get burned on unqualified handoffs, and how buyers learn to disengage from nurture sequences entirely.
What Engagement Tells You – and What It Does Not
Engagement tells you a buyer noticed something. It tells you a message was not immediately deleted, a topic generated enough curiosity for a click, a piece of content was considered worth saving. That is useful context. It is not a buying signal.
A contact who opens every email in a sequence and downloads every asset may be a researcher, a student, a competitor, or a current customer with no purchase authority. High engagement with no intent pattern is noise. Treating it as signal wastes sales capacity and erodes the credibility of the marketing-to-sales handoff.
The Intent Pattern Stack – A Three-Signal Cluster Model
The Intent Pattern Stack is a framework for reading intent from signal clusters rather than individual behaviors. A genuine intent pattern requires three signal types to be present simultaneously:
- Signal type 1 – Topic convergence. The buyer’s engagement concentrates on a specific problem or solution category over multiple touchpoints, not scattered across general educational content.
- Signal type 2 – Role escalation. New contacts from the same account engage with the content, particularly contacts with decision-making or budget authority. Single-contact engagement rarely indicates organisational intent.
- Signal type 3 – Recency compression. The gap between engagement events shortens. A buyer who engaged once a month and is now engaging twice a week is accelerating – that acceleration is the signal.
When all three are present, the pattern indicates a buyer who is actively building a case internally. That is the moment to change what the nurture system sends – not before.
Why Treating Clicks as Buying Signals Burns Pipeline
Sales teams that receive leads based on engagement scores rather than intent patterns face the same problem every quarter: they call contacts who are not ready, the contacts disengage, and the sales team stops trusting marketing-qualified leads. The damage is not just the lost opportunity. It is the breakdown of the feedback loop that would otherwise improve the system. When sales stops reporting back on lead quality, the nurture system loses its most important input – and continues operating on the same flawed assumptions.
Rebuilding Nurture as Decision-Support Infrastructure
The reframe that makes email nurture systems work is this: the system’s job is not to deliver content. It is to reduce decision risk for the buyer at each stage of their uncertainty. That is a fundamentally different design brief – and it produces a fundamentally different system.
The Buyer Confidence Architecture – Three Stages of Decision Risk
The Buyer Confidence Architecture replaces TOFU/MOFU/BOFU with three stages defined by the buyer’s internal decision question:
- Problem Clarity. The buyer’s question: “Do I understand this problem well enough to justify investigating a solution?” Content at this stage names the problem precisely, quantifies the cost of inaction, and does not pitch a solution. Pitching at this stage destroys confidence rather than building it.
- Risk Reduction. The buyer’s question: “How do others evaluate and solve this? What can go wrong?” Content at this stage shows evaluation frameworks, surfaces common failure modes, and provides social proof that reduces the perceived risk of moving forward. This is where most nurture programs under-invest.
- Internal Justification. The buyer’s question: “Can I defend this decision to my stakeholders?” Content at this stage provides the language, data, and framing the buyer needs to build internal consensus. It is not about convincing the buyer – the buyer is already convinced. It is about giving them the tools to convince everyone else.
What Each Stage Needs – and What It Cannot Tolerate
Stage 1 cannot tolerate product mentions. Stage 2 cannot tolerate vague testimonials or case studies that omit failure. Stage 3 cannot tolerate content that speaks to the individual buyer – it must speak to the committee. Getting this wrong at any stage does not just fail to move the buyer forward. It signals that the sending organisation does not understand the buyer’s actual situation, which is the fastest way to lose the trust that nurture is designed to build.
How Message Design Changes When the Goal Is Confidence
When the goal is confidence rather than conversion, three things change in how messages are written. First, the message acknowledges where the buyer likely is in their decision process rather than assuming a stage and pitching into it. Second, the message removes an obstacle rather than promoting a capability. Third, the message ends with something the buyer can do independently – a question to ask internally, a framework to apply, a risk to investigate – rather than a call to action that benefits the sender.
How Lead Management Data Makes Nurture Intelligent
The reason email nurture systems that are well-designed still underperform is usually not the content. It is the absence of a data feed. Without a functioning lead management system providing fit, intent, and engagement signals in real time, even a well-designed nurture sequence is operating blind.
The CRM-to-Nurture Data Feed – What Signals Matter and Where They Live
The CRM is not just a contact database. It is the intelligence layer that should be continuously informing which nurture track a buyer is on, whether they should advance or pause, and when their behavior warrants a sales conversation. The specific signals that matter: lead score movement (not just score level), page visit patterns on the website, content consumption by topic cluster, and sales activity notes that indicate the buyer has expressed specific concerns or timelines.
Revenue operations owns this data layer. When revenue operations and demand generation are not aligned on what signals feed the nurture system, the system defaults to time-based sequencing – which is the Assumption Gap in its most visible form.
Buying Group Engagement – Why Single-Contact Nurture Fails Complex Sales
In B2B sales involving more than two stakeholders, single-contact nurture is structurally insufficient. The buying committee does not share an inbox. The economic buyer, the technical evaluator, the end user, and the internal champion each have different questions at different stages – and a nurture system that treats the account as a single contact is missing most of the decision-making activity.
Effective buying group nurture requires the sequencing logic to change based on which roles are engaging. When only end users are engaged and economic buyers are absent, the system should not be escalating toward a sales handoff. It should be sending content designed to give the end user the language to bring the economic buyer into the conversation. The unit of intent is the account, not the individual contact. The CRM must be able to surface account-level engagement patterns – not just individual contact scores – for this to work.
Closed-Loop Sales Feedback as a Nurture Design Input
The most underused input in nurture system design is sales feedback. Every deal that closes, stalls, or is lost contains information about what buyers needed that the nurture system either provided or failed to provide. That information should be systematically captured and fed back into sequence design – which messages to keep, which to retire, which objections to address earlier, and which content assumptions to challenge.
Without a closed-loop reporting structure, the nurture system cannot improve. It runs the same sequences on the same assumptions indefinitely, producing the same pipeline results and generating the same post-quarter frustration.
Where AI Fits – and Where It Breaks the System
AI does not make nurture systems smarter by default. It makes them faster. If the underlying system is built on the Assumption Gap – guessed stages, engagement-as-intent, confidence-free sequencing – AI will help the team execute that broken logic at greater speed and scale. That is not an improvement. It is an acceleration of the damage.
AI as Signal Amplifier – What Good Looks Like
Used correctly, AI in email nurture systems does three things. It processes signal clusters faster than any manual lead scoring process, identifying intent patterns from the Intent Pattern Stack in near real time. It adapts sequence content based on behavioral signals without requiring manual segment updates. And it identifies the point at which a buyer’s engagement pattern indicates they have moved to a different decision stage – triggering a track change before the current messages become irrelevant.
The teams winning with AI in nurture are not sending more emails. They are sending fewer, better-timed messages – because AI is helping them read when to send, not just generating content to fill a cadence.
AI as Volume Engine – How It Scales Irrelevance
The common misuse of AI in lead nurturing automation is deploying it to generate more content variations, more personalised subject lines, and more frequent sends – without improving the signal quality that informs when and why those sends should happen. This is the volume engine failure mode. It produces higher send volume, marginally better open rates, and no improvement in pipeline contribution – because the sequencing logic is still assumption-driven.
The Relevance Kill-Switch – Stopping Sequences Before They Erode Trust
Every nurture system needs a relevance kill-switch: a defined point at which the system stops sending to a contact because the signals indicate the current track is no longer appropriate. This is not a suppression list. It is an active decision logic built into the sequence – if engagement drops below a defined threshold, or if the contact’s behavior indicates they have moved outside the topic cluster, the sequence pauses and the contact is routed to re-engagement or held for a signal-triggered restart.
Stopping a sequence at the right moment is as important as starting it. A buyer who receives one well-timed, relevant message after a period of silence will respond better than a buyer who has been receiving weekly emails they have stopped reading. Trust is not built by persistence. It is built by demonstrating that the system knows when to stop.
What a Working Email Nurture System Actually Looks Like
When the data layer is connected, the sequencing logic is intent-triggered, and the content is designed around buyer confidence rather than content stages, the system behaves differently in ways that are immediately visible.
System Inputs – The Data Layer Requirements
A functioning email nurture system requires four data inputs to operate with intelligence rather than assumption: lead fit data (does this contact match the ICP?), intent pattern data (is this contact showing the three-signal cluster?), buying group coverage data (which roles at this account are engaged?), and sales feedback data (what did recent deals tell us about what buyers needed at each stage?). If any of these inputs are absent, the system will compensate with assumptions – and the Assumption Gap returns.
Sequencing Logic – Intent-Triggered, Not Time-Triggered
The sequencing logic in a working system fires on signals, not calendars. A contact moves from Stage 1 to Stage 2 of the Buyer Confidence Architecture when their signal pattern indicates Problem Clarity has been reached – not because fourteen days have elapsed. The transition criteria must be defined explicitly: what signal combination constitutes readiness to advance, what absence of signal triggers a pause, and what signal combination triggers a sales alert.
Output Metrics That Matter – Pipeline Contribution, Not Open Rates
The metric that tells you whether an email nurture system is working is pipeline contribution: the proportion of pipeline that engaged with nurture content before entering a sales conversation. Open rates, click rates, and unsubscribe rates measure system activity. Pipeline contribution measures system outcomes. A program that produces strong engagement metrics and weak pipeline contribution is the Assumption Gap in its final form – busy, measurable, and not working.
FAQ – Email Nurture Systems That Build Intent
What is an email nurture system and how is it different from a drip campaign?
An email nurture system is a signal-driven architecture that adapts sequencing based on buyer behavior and intent patterns. A drip campaign is a time-based content delivery schedule. The difference is not the technology – it is the logic. Drip campaigns advance on calendars. Nurture systems advance on signals. Only one of them responds to what buyers actually do.
Why do most B2B email nurture programs fail to generate pipeline?
They fail because they are built on the Assumption Gap – sequences designed around internal beliefs about buyer stages rather than actual buyer signals. When the system cannot read intent, it defaults to activity: more sends, more content, more cadence. Activity without signal produces engagement metrics and no pipeline.
What is the difference between an engagement signal and a buyer intent pattern?
An engagement signal is a single behavior – an open, a click, a download. An intent pattern is a cluster: topic convergence, role escalation, and recency compression occurring together over time. Engagement tells you a buyer noticed something. Intent patterns tell you a buyer is actively building a case to purchase. The distinction determines whether a sales handoff is premature or well-timed.
How does lead management data improve email nurture performance?
Lead management data – fit scores, CRM signals, buying group coverage, sales feedback – tells the nurture system who is engaging, at what stage of their decision, and whether the account as a whole is showing genuine intent. Without this data feed, nurture sequences operate on assumptions. With it, they operate on evidence.
How should AI be used in email nurture without scaling irrelevance?
AI should be used to read signal patterns faster, adapt sequences in near real time, and trigger the relevance kill-switch when engagement patterns indicate a track is no longer appropriate. It should not be used to generate more content variations or increase send volume. AI amplifies the quality of the underlying system – which means fixing the system before deploying AI, not using AI to compensate for a broken one.
